No. 12 Men's Lacrosse Advances To Pilgrim League Championships With 7-4 Win Over Lasell

SPRINGFIELD, Mass., May 4, 2005 – Springfield College junior attackman
Taylor Brown (Portsmouth, R.I.) tallied three goals to lead the No. 12 Pride over Lasell College, 7-4, in the semifinals of the Pilgrim League Tournament in men’s lacrosse this afternoon on Benedum Field.
The top-seeded Pride (11-4), which has won 11-straight games, will host the Pilgrim League Championship game this Saturday (May 7) against second-seeded Western New England with a berth in the NCAA Division III Tournament on the line. SC, which will be making its sixth-straight tournament final appearance, has won four of the last five Pilgrim League titles.
Lasell (10-5) sophomore attackman Al Zayac gave the Lasers a 1-0 lead with 6:25 to play in the first quarter, before SC senior attackman
Shawn Cofrin (Derry, N.H.) evened the score 43 seconds later to make the score 1-1 after the first 15 minutes of play.
Four unanswered Pride goals, including two-straight by senior midfielder
Derek Pedrick (Saratoga Springs, N.Y.) in a 1:36 span, put the Pride up, 5-1, with 4:56 to play in the first half. The first of two goals in the game by Lasell junior attackman Louis Lucchetti made the halftime score, 5-2, in favor of the Pride.
Brown’s second goal of the game with 39 seconds on the clock accounted for the only goal of the third quarter, as SC led, 6-2.
Brown’s third goal came on an extra-man opportunity to put the Pride up, 7-2, with 14:13 to play in the game. Lucchetti’s second goal at the 2:33 mark, followed 26 seconds later by a tally by junior attackman Kyle Minaker, finished the game for the 7-4 final.
Springfield sophomore goalie
Kyle Cloutier (South Hadley, Mass.) picked up his ninth victory of the season, turning away eight shots, while Lasell freshman Mark DeMieri was credited with 12 saves.
